#3af59c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3af59c is composed of 22.7% red, 96.1%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 151.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 59.4%. #3af59c color hex could be obtained by blending #74ffff with #00eb39.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#3af59c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000805 is the darkest color, while #f5f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3af59c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929d98 is the less saturated color, while #32fd9c is the most saturated one.
